        It's Magpuls take on the ARES FMG from the 80s.

        The Magpul reps at the 2008 SHOT show said it's a non-functional prototype, they have no intention of producing it and they made it to show what they are capable of.

        My guess it would be classified as a SBR. Short barrel has a stock, can not be fired when folded in half.
